A key aspect of searching your path of travel is scanning the environment for potential hazards. This practice is crucial for motorcycle safety, as it helps riders to be aware of their surroundings and anticipate any dangers that may arise. By actively observing the road, other vehicles, pedestrians, and road conditions, a rider can make informed decisions and react effectively to avoid accidents.

This approach encourages you to use a wide field of vision rather than focusing too narrowly on any single aspect of the environment. It helps in identifying obstacles, traffic signals, and changes in road conditions that could impact your ride.
